What is Halal Perfume?
Halal perfume is made from ingredients that comply with Islamic law. This means that the components used in the fragrance are free from any alcohol or animal-derived substances that are considered haram (forbidden).
Halal perfumes are typically oil-based, which makes them long-lasting and suitable for various occasions, including the sacred month of Ramadan.
Why Choose Halal Perfume Oils?
Spiritual Significance: Fragrance plays a significant role in Islamic tradition. It’s believed that wearing a pleasant scent can enhance one’s spirituality and presence during prayers and gatherings.
Long-lasting: Oil-based perfumes tend to last longer than alcohol-based ones. A few drops can keep you fragrant throughout the day, making them perfect for long fasting hours during Ramadan.
Natural Ingredients: Halal perfumes often use natural ingredients, making them a healthier choice for your skin and overall well-being.
Versatility: Many halal perfume oils can be worn by both men and women, making them an excellent choice for family use.

Tips for Wearing Halal Perfume Oils
Apply After Showering: For better absorption and longevity, apply your perfume oil after showering when your skin is still slightly damp.
Pulse Points: Apply the perfume oil to pulse points such as wrists, behind the ears, and neck for a more intense fragrance experience.
Layering Scents: Consider layering different halal perfume oils to create a unique scent that reflects your personality.
Storage: Keep your perfume oils in a cool, dark place to preserve their integrity and longevity.
